Users who have used wire ropes know that after using wire ropes, the diameter of wire ropes will become smaller due to wear and tear, and corrosion and broken wires will gradually appear. These conditions show that wear, corrosion and fatigue wire breakage are the main causes of wire rope failure.
Manganese phosphating has been used in machinery industry for decades. The surface of steel gear of automobile gearbox is treated with manganese phosphating film, which can ensure that the gear can be used normally for more than ten years without wear. The surfaces of worm gear and piston ring are treated by manganese phosphating coating, which can improve the wear resistance and corrosion resistance of steel surface, thus effectively inhibiting the occurrence of wear and corrosion and further prolonging the service life.
The purpose of manganese phosphating coated wire rope is to improve the wear resistance and corrosion resistance of the wire rope surface, so as to achieve the purpose of improving the service life.
